Govt hospitals in Kerala lack equipment, doctors, medicine: Congress

Thiruvananthapuram, June 30 (UNI) The Congress party in Kerala has alleged that the Government Medical College hospitals in the state are facing a shortage of surgical equipment, medicines, doctors, and staff, showing the government’s neglect and apathy towards the health sector.
Responding to the government apathy, KPCC President Sunny Joseph said the party workers will hold protest programmes in front of all the medical college hospitals in the state on July 1.
The protest marches and sit-in demonstrations will be held in front of all government medical colleges in the state under the leadership of District Congress Committees (DCCs) at 10 am on July 1, Sunny Joseph added.
